Objective
By the end of this lesson, the student will be able to identify and create various Halloween shapes using simple crafting techniques. They will learn to recognize shapes like circles, triangles, and squares while having fun with Halloween-themed crafts!
Materials and Prep
- Colored paper (orange, black, purple, green)
- Scissors
- Glue or tape
- Markers or crayons
- Optional: String or yarn for hanging crafts
Before starting the lesson, make sure to prepare a clean workspace. Review safety rules for using scissors and remind the student to ask for help if needed.
Activities
-
Shape Hunt
Go on a shape hunt around the house or outside to find Halloween shapes. Look for pumpkins (circles), ghosts (squares), and witches' hats (triangles). Discuss each shape you find!
-
Crafting Halloween Shapes
Using the colored paper, help the student cut out different shapes. Create a pumpkin from a circle, a ghost from an oval, and a witch's hat from a triangle. Glue them onto a larger piece of paper to create a Halloween scene!
-
Shape Storytime
Read a Halloween-themed story together and ask the student to point out the shapes they see in the illustrations. After reading, encourage them to draw their favorite character using the shapes they learned!
